Biography
Hans Rudolf Rahn (1805-1868) was a Swiss engraver and lithographer known for his portraits and illustrations. Born in Zürich and later living in Wil, he developed a reputation for his meticulous detail and realistic renderings. His works often depicted prominent figures of the time, capturing their likeness with great accuracy. Rahn's engravings and lithographs were highly sought after and helped preserve the visual record of the era.
